Today's Hard|Forum Post
Today's Hard|Forum Post

Tuesday October 25, 2011

Grand Theft Auto 5 Officially Announced

Attention one and all, Grand Theft Auto 5 has officially been announced! Grandstanding politicians, psychotic lawyers and big media have another game to blame for everything bad happening anywhere in the world. big grin

News Image